Sorry in advance if I don't explain this clearly. I will try my best to clarify what I am trying to do. Without further ado...Suppose you have a series of numbers on a page (separated by only a space) where brackets indicate the current page you are on.
It looks like this on the page:
[1] 2 3
The HTML looks like this:
<tr>
<td>
[<a href='link1.php'>1</a>] <a href='link2.php'>2</a> <a href='link3.php'>3</a>
</td>
</tr>
I am simply trying to select the next page number based on the current. I imagine I need to use some form of following-sibling but all I have come up with is //tr/td/a/following-sibling::a[1], which is obviously incorrect. It selects 2 when on page 1 but not 3 when on page 2 as expected. I would have tried to use a[text()[contains(.,'[')]] to select the current-page but the brackets are outside the anchor as opposed to inside. Eek!?

The next page after 2, will be found by:
First we select the current page based on its string content
//tr/td/a[.='2']
, and from there select the first following-sibling.To do this without knowing the current page, we will instead select the a element following the "]".
And in case that there is no current page, we will default to the first a element.
